Overview
An RJ45 port is a standardized network connector interface found on computers, network devices, and telecommunications equipment. The acronym RJ45 stands for "Registered Jack 45," referring to the physical connector standard defined by the International Electrotechnical Commission (IEC 60603-7). This port accepts standard Ethernet cables to establish wired network connections.
Physical Characteristics
The RJ45 connector is a small, rectangular plastic plug measuring approximately 15mm × 13mm × 8.5mm. It features 8 pins arranged in a specific configuration within the connector's socket. The connector design uses a push-and-click mechanism to secure the cable, with a small tab that must be pressed to release the connection. The standardized design ensures compatibility across all major manufacturers and networking equipment.
Speed and Performance Ratings
RJ45 ports support varying transmission speeds depending on the cable category used. Cat 5e cables support up to 1 Gbps (gigabit), Cat 6 cables support up to 10 Gbps, and Cat 6a/Cat 7 cables also support 10 Gbps with better shielding. Older Cat 5 cables support 100 Mbps, while legacy Cat 3 cables support 10 Mbps. Modern devices typically use Cat 5e or Cat 6 cables for optimal performance.
Common Applications
RJ45 ports are ubiquitous in networking infrastructure. Desktop computers and laptops use them for direct network connections. Routers, network switches, and modems feature multiple RJ45 ports for device connectivity. Servers, printers, security cameras, smart home devices, and gaming consoles also incorporate RJ45 ports. In enterprise environments, patch panels and network equipment use standardized RJ45 connections for organized infrastructure.
Advantages Over Wireless
Wired RJ45 connections provide faster speeds, lower latency, and more reliable connectivity compared to WiFi. They are essential for bandwidth-intensive applications, professional work requiring stable connections, and locations where wireless signals are weak. RJ45 ports also provide continuous power for certain devices through Power over Ethernet (PoE) technology, eliminating the need for separate power supplies.

What is the difference between RJ45 and RJ11?
RJ45 is used for Ethernet networking with 8 pins and supports data speeds up to 10 Gbps. RJ11 is used for telephone lines with 4-6 pins and only supports voice transmission. RJ45 connectors are larger and designed for data networking, while RJ11 connectors are smaller and for telephone service.
What does Cat 5e, Cat 6, and Cat 7 mean?
Cat numbers refer to Ethernet cable categories that determine maximum data speeds. Cat 5e supports up to 1 Gbps, Cat 6 supports up to 10 Gbps, and Cat 7 also supports 10 Gbps with better shielding for reducing interference. Higher category cables offer improved performance and support for future technologies.
Can I use any Ethernet cable with an RJ45 port?
Yes, any standard RJ45 Ethernet cable works with RJ45 ports, though different cable categories offer different speeds. Using a Cat 5e or higher cable ensures modern network speeds. Older Cat 5 or Cat 3 cables may limit connection speed, so using an appropriate category cable for your network is recommended.
